J. Korean Med. Sci. · Mar 2020
Analysis on 54 Mortality Cases of Coronavirus Disease 2019 in the Republic of Korea from January 19 to March 10, 2020.
- Korean Society of Infectious Diseases and Korea Centers for Disease Control and Prevention.
- J. Korean Med. Sci. 2020 Mar 30; 35 (12): e132e132.
AbstractSince the identification of the first case of coronavirus disease 2019 (COVID-19), the global number of confirmed cases as of March 15, 2020, is 156,400, with total death in 5,833 (3.7%) worldwide. Here, we summarize the morality data from February 19 when the first mortality occurred to 0 am, March 10, 2020, in Korea with comparison to other countries. The overall case fatality rate of COVID-19 in Korea was 0.7% as of 0 am, March 10, 2020.© 2020 The Korean Academy of Medical Sciences.
